@charset "utf-8";
/* CSS Document */

/* CSS Document */

@import url('https://fonts.googleapis.com/css2?family=Pirata+One&display=swap');

.signboard {
	width: 400px;  /* ANCHO DEL CARTEL */
	height: 150px;
	position: relative;
	animation: swinging 1.5s ease-in-out infinite alternate;
  transform-origin: 200px 13px;

}


.sign {   /*  LETRERO  */
	width: 46%; /* ANCHO DEL LETRERO  */
	height: 80px;
	 background-image: url("../images/papiro3.png"); /* foto de fondo  */

	
  background-size:100% 100%;
position: absolute;
	bottom: 50;
	left: 25%;
	top: 20%;
	font-size: 27px;
	color: saddlebrown;
font-family: 'Pirata One', cursive;
font-weight: 600; /* negrita o grosor del texto, bold: 700, normal:400 , lighter: 200-300 , bolder:800-900 (ultra bold)*/
  /* tamaño del texto*/
letter-spacing: 0.2px; /* espacio entre cada letra*/
	text-align: center;
	line-height: 87px;

}

.sign:hover {
filter: drop-shadow(0px 0px 40px red);
    }

.strings {  /* cuerda*/
	width: 60px;
	height: 60px;
	border: 3px solid brown;
	position: absolute;
	border-right: none;
	border-bottom: none;
	transform: rotate(45deg);
	top: 16px;
	left: 160px;
}

.pin {  
	width: 10px;
	height: 10px;
	border-radius: 50%;
	position: absolute;
}



.pin.top {
	background: gray;
	left: 187px;
	
}

.pin.left,
.pin.right {
	background: brown;
	top: 40px;
	box-shadow: 0 2px 0 rgba(255, 255, 255, 0.3);
}

.pin.left {
	left: 146px;
}

.pin.right {
	right: 167px;  /* ubicacion del boton rojo derecho*/
}

@keyframes swinging {
	from {
		transform: rotate(10deg);
	}

	to {
		transform: rotate(-10deg);
	}
}
